Subject: DR drill Thursday — admin table bulk edits

On-call: during Thursday's drill, bulk edits in the Orcastra admin table will be disabled at 10:00. Failover restores them from the Bravura replica; verify row counts match post-cutover. Escalate any drift over 0.1%. To unlock the replica's admin console during the drill, use the recovery passphrase below.

vault phrase of taweg-kafof = oliax-zorael

**Off-site run checklist — item 7: key-card stock, Renner Quay site**

Confirm the carton of blank key cards for the new Renner Quay office is sealed with two tamper strips and counted against the requisition sheet before loading. On arrival, the receiving lead must verify both strips are intact and initial the count. For the actual hand-over from the courier, apply the following instruction precisely.

handover note for yagef-bagep: the drudor pelius courier leaves the kasdor zorvan norir ledger at gate 8016 under passcode 755406

Ticket: spare hardware storage, Room G4 at Larkspur Court. Couriers keep dropping monitor boxes at reception instead of the store — please walk deliveries down yourself or grab someone from IT if it's heavy. Shelve anything new on the left rack and jot it in the clipboard sheet. The door auto-locks behind you, so don't get stuck. Entry code for G4 is below.

staff pass of kawip-hawef = bdg-QLP-2

The revised commission scheme for Vantrell Systems took effect at the start of the quarter. Accelerators now trigger at 110% of quota rather than 100%, and clawback windows extend to 90 days. Modelled payout costs fall roughly 6% against the prior structure, assuming flat attainment. Field feedback from the Harwick and Dolmere regions is mixed but manageable. Finance should monitor accrual variances monthly and flag deviations above 3%. The following note concerns related business plans and must not be circulated outside this team.

management briefing: Project Ulavan slips by two quarters because of the staffing delay.